From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.44 [gcide]:

Schemer \Schem"er\, noun One who forms schemes; a projector; esp., a plotter; an intriguer.

Schemers and confederates in guilt. --Paley.

From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:

schemer

noun: a planner who draws up a personal scheme of action [syn: {plotter}]
